Zeng Xu saw with his own eyes that this Judger once fiercely clashed with a swift-attacking Rampage. Within tens of seconds, the two Mechas advanced and retreated, shooting over a hundred meters in a straight line, exchanging hundreds of moves. The sound of their punches and kicks colliding was as incessant as a machine gun spitting fire.
Although this Judger eventually succeeded in severely injuring the Rampage, it also suffered a critical failure in its drive system and was pierced through the abdomen by another Rampage attacking sideways.
Then came the third Judger.
This airborne-striking Judger was kicked in the calf by a rapidly accelerating Rampage while still in the air. As the Mecha spun towards the ground like an out-of-control helicopter rotor, another Rampage shot upward and kneed it in the lower back. The entire Mecha fell to the ground like a broken puppet.
The fourth one, during a high-speed chase, was entangled by the arms by a Rampage and then had its chest pierced by another Rampage with an ion dagger.
The fifth, the sixth......
Ten minutes later, in front of Zeng Xu and Hamshik, only one desperately struggling Judger remained.
At this point, the minds of the two were completely blank. Six entire Judgers were annihilated, and the cost to the bandit army’s Rampages was merely two Mechas severely damaged and six slightly damaged.
Even though they had the advantage in numbers, they ultimately shattered the terrifying legend of the Judger, trampling this seemingly invincible monster underfoot!
The two stared blankly at their long-range viewer screens.
They involuntarily began to wonder how much shock and encouragement bringing back the record of this thrilling battle would provide their comrades.
Wood gasped for breath, thick nutrient liquid bubbling ceaselessly.
At this moment, his head was splitting with pain. The excessive drain of mental energy had left him unable to sustain high-intensity combat.
Beside him, six black Mecha wrecks were burning. Those devil-like enemies calmly encircled him at an unhurried pace. If they hadn’t relied on superior numbers, how could they possibly have defeated him?
A sense of a hero’s end suddenly overwhelmed Wood.
Dodging an attack from a Devil Mecha, he frantically delivered two consecutive slashes to push back two other Devil Mechas, then suddenly lunged forward in an attempt to break through.
A Devil Mecha blocking his path fell for the trick.
Wood laughed wildly. Ignoring the enemies suddenly closing in behind him, he exerted all his strength to plunge the ion light saber into the chest of the Devil Mecha.
At least, I killed one!
Two ion daggers simultaneously pierced into Wood’s cockpit.
In the viscous green nutrient liquid, a cloud of blood-red blossomed like a flower, flowing out through the opening in the cockpit, streak by streak, strand by strand, flamboyant yet desperate.
Wood laughed crazily and fell.
Suddenly, a surge of blood rushed to his throat, blocking his windpipe and silencing his laughter. Blood bubbles foamed from his mouth, his eyes bulging lifelessly like a dead fish, staring fixedly at the gradually tilting heavens and earth.
In front of him, a miniature Mecha ejected from the back of the Devil Mecha. Through the transparent cockpit of the miniature Mecha, he could even see the slight sarcastic smile on the Mech Knight’s lips.
The ion light saber lodged in the hollow shell of the Devil Mecha gradually extinguished as it lost engine support.
Wood struggled, blood bubbles spurting from his mouth like a fountain. His throat emitted a gurgling sound, but he couldn’t utter another word.
The earth finally rushed up to meet him.
The entire world vibrated lightly twice before turning pitch black.
